oatllo

Jak używać pętli while

Czym jest pętla while w PHP?

Pętla while w języku PHP jest jedną z podstawowych konstrukcji służących do iteracji. Umożliwia wykonywanie bloku kodu tak długo, jak spełniony jest określony warunek. Jest to doskonałe rozwiązanie w sytuacjach, gdy nie znamy z góry liczby iteracji, a chcemy kontynuować działanie pętli do momentu spełnienia określonego kryterium.

Podstawowa składnia pętli while

Składnia pętli while jest prosta:

while (warunek) {
    // blok kodu
}

Ważne jest, aby upewnić się, że warunek w pętli while w końcu stanie się nieprawdziwy; w przeciwnym razie pętla będzie działać w nieskończoność, co spowoduje niebezpieczne zachowanie skryptu.

Przykład użycia pętli while

Przykładowa pętla while mogłaby wyglądać następująco:

$licznik = 1;
while ($licznik <= 10) {
    echo $licznik;
    $licznik++;
}

W powyższym przykładzie pętla wypisuje liczby od 1 do 10. Jest to podstawowy i często spotykany sposób używania pętli while w PHP.

Kiedy stosować pętlę while?

Pętla while jest szczególnie przydatna, gdy warunki iteracji są bardziej złożone lub gdy zależność od zewnętrznych czynników ma duże znaczenie. Przykłady zastosowania to np. odczytywanie danych z bazy danych, przetwarzanie formularzy oraz w grach, gdzie pętla kontroluje stan rozgrywki.

Zapraszamy do zapoznania się z poniższymi artykułami, które dogłębnie omawiają pętle w PHP, jak również różnorodne techniki programowania, które pozwolą Ci na efektywne korzystanie z pętli while i innych konstrukcji programistycznych.

Lekcje z kursów: